13. Thermal pretreatment of municipal solid waste
Master-uppsats, Högskolan i Borås/Institutionen IngenjörshögskolanSammanfattning : A kinetic study of the pyrolysis of municipal solid waste (MSW) was carried out bythermogravimetric analysis (TGA). Different runs were performed at heating rates of 5, 10and 150C/min. The effect of the N2, CO2 and O2 gas with different combination in theprocess was also evaluated. LÄS MER
14. Torrefaction of biomass : a comparative and kinetic study of thermal decomposition for Norway spruce stump, poplar and fuel tree chips
Uppsats för yrkesexamina på avancerad nivå, SLU/Dept. of Energy and TechnologySammanfattning : Stump biomass is energy rich and stump harvesting for use as fuel become more and more interesting in Sweden. Swedish Forest Agency (2009) has estimated that stump harvesting in Sweden would respond to an annual energy supply of 57 TWh/year. However, stump has not been recognized as a bioenergy resource in Sweden. LÄS MER
